Resilience and Redemption in 'El Himno' by Difonia

Difonia's song 'El Himno' delves into themes of resilience, self-reflection, and redemption. The lyrics express a deep sense of personal failure and the struggle to rebuild after disappointment. The opening lines reveal a sense of disillusionment, as the narrator grapples with the realization that they have let down those they care about. This sets the stage for a journey of introspection and the quest for personal growth.

The chorus serves as a powerful mantra of perseverance. The repeated line, 'No me importa continuar tener o derrumbar lo ideal es construir,' emphasizes the importance of moving forward and building anew, regardless of past mistakes. This sentiment is further reinforced by the narrator's indifference to whether they are more, less, or the same as they once were. It highlights a focus on progress and the value of the journey over the destination.

The song also touches on themes of love and loss. The narrator addresses a significant other, acknowledging their role as a vital part of their life and expressing regret for the pain caused. The plea for forgiveness and understanding underscores the human desire for reconciliation and the hope for a second chance. The repetition of 'Yo te falle' (I failed you) and the call to 'trata de perdonar' (try to forgive) and 'trata de olvidar' (try to forget) reflect a deep yearning for redemption and the healing of emotional wounds.

Ultimately, 'El Himno' is a poignant exploration of the human condition, capturing the complexities of personal failure, the drive to rebuild, and the enduring hope for forgiveness and growth. It resonates with anyone who has faced setbacks and seeks to find strength in the process of rebuilding their life.
